Coconut Oil Market Dynamics Influenced by Fluctuating Raw Material Prices
The global coconut oil market is witnessing steady expansion, driven by rising consumer awareness regarding health benefits, growing demand for plant-based ingredients, and increasing applications across food, pharmaceutical, and personal care industries. The global coconut oil market size was valued at USD 5.82 billion in 2023, which is estimated to be valued at USD 6.11 billion in 2024 and projected to reach USD 8.94 bill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 5.60% from 2024 to 2031.
Coconut oil, derived from the kernel or meat of mature coconuts harvested from the coconut palm, has evolved from a traditional cooking oil into a multifunctional ingredient widely used in cosmetics, nutraceuticals, and therapeutic products. The market is benefiting from shifting consumer preferences toward natural, organic, and clean-label products, particularly in emerging and developed economies.

Market Overview
Coconut oil is rich in medium-chain triglycerides (MCTs), lauric acid, and antioxidants, which contribute to its growing popularity across various industries. Historically used in tropical regions for culinary purposes, coconut oil has gained global acceptance due to increasing health consciousness and the surge in demand for natural and minimally processed products.
The market growth is also supported by expanding retail distribution channels, including supermarkets, specialty health stores, and e-commerce platforms. Additionally, the rising vegan and ketogenic diet trends have further strengthened demand for coconut oil as a plant-based fat alternative.

By Type
Refined Coconut Oil
Refined coconut oil holds a significant share of the global market due to its neutral flavor, extended shelf life, and affordability. It is commonly used in commercial food processing, baking, and frying applications. Refined oil undergoes bleaching and deodorizing processes, making it suitable for high-temperature cooking and industrial applications.
Food manufacturers prefer refined coconut oil for large-scale production due to its consistency and cost efficiency.
Unrefined (Virgin) Coconut Oil
Unrefined or virgin coconut oil is extracted through cold-pressing or wet-milling processes without chemical treatment. It retains natural aroma, flavor, and nutrients, making it highly popular among health-conscious consumers.
Virgin coconut oil is extensively used in:
-
Premium culinary applications
-
Nutraceutical supplements
-
Cosmetic and skincare formulations
-
Aromatherapy products
The increasing demand for organic and minimally processed products is driving strong growth in the unrefined coconut oil segment.

Regional Analysis
Asia-Pacific
Asia-Pacific dominates the global coconut oil market due to abundant coconut production in countries such as the Philippines, Indonesia, India, and Sri Lanka. The region benefits from strong domestic consumption and export activities.
India and Southeast Asian countries represent major producers and exporters, while rising urbanization and increasing disposable income are further supporting market growth.
North America
North America is a key growth region driven by increasing health awareness and strong demand for organic and natural products. The United States and Canada are witnessing rising adoption of coconut oil in health supplements, keto diets, and natural cosmetic products.
E-commerce expansion and premium product offerings are also boosting regional market growth.
Europe
Europe holds a substantial market share due to rising demand for plant-based ingredients and natural personal care products. Countries such as Germany, the UK, and France are witnessing strong growth in organic coconut oil consumption.
Strict regulations regarding product labeling and sustainability are encouraging manufacturers to adopt high-quality processing standards.
Latin America
Latin America is emerging as a growing market due to increasing health consciousness and expanding food processing industries. Brazil and Mexico are key contributors in the region.
Middle East & Africa
The Middle East & Africa region is gradually expanding due to rising demand for personal care products and increasing awareness regarding natural health supplements. However, market penetration remains moderate compared to other regions.
